The Bull Shark is Going on a Road Trip

Categories: Fish | Sharks |
1 Comment

Our bull shark (Carcharhinus leucas), the only one on display in the western United States, will be moving to a new home out of state soon. She is outgrowing her current habitat in Shark Lagoon.
